alien defence: the last stand against the galaxy’s toughest invaders

In 2850, alien swarms flood the cosmos, hunting organic energy. Humanity’s only hope is a network of laser turrets, plasma cannons, and experimental tech. One player takes command, builds defenses, and watches the alien tide crumble under precise fire. The stakes are simple: stop the ooze, protect the last colonies, and prove Earth’s resilience.

Strategy

Winning isn’t about brute force; it’s about timing and placement. Start with low‑cost laser emitters to thin early waves. As resources swell, upgrade to split‑beam cannons that pierce multiple foes. Keep an eye on alien evolution—some units gain shields after three kills. Drop EMP bursts right before they adapt, and you’ll reset their defenses. Balance energy income with tower upgrades; overspending leaves gaps, underspending stalls progress. Experiment with hybrid layouts: a wall of rapid‑fire turrets backed by a few high‑damage plasma spikes creates a choke point that forces the swarm into a kill zone. Every level introduces a new alien type, so adapt your layout on the fly. The deeper you go, the tighter the margins, and the more satisfying the victory.
